This review is from: Leatherman 830306 E300 Folding Knife With Straight Edge and Blade Launcher Opening (Tools & Home Improvement)
I bought the c300 about a year ago and wrote a five star review for it. I bought this e300 because I liked the c300 so much and thought the carabiner clip/bottle opener might be nice. It is nice, and doesn't add any bulk really. (I still don't want screwdivers and other tools.)The thing that gets me though, is this knife opens so much easier -- with the blade launcher alone -- no wrist action needed, just a flick of the finger. Maybe this is how they are all supposed to be, and my c300 doesn't work as well as it should? It still is very nice and handy knife. I can see a few differences in the blade launcher, not many. Is this model newer or older? Is the mechanism different, or can my experience be attributed to sample variatios? I don't know. At this writing the e300 costs about $5 more than the c300. It works better and has that added caribiner. You have to decide if it is worth it to you, but it the two were side by side and I had to choose, I'd choose this one and pay the extra. |
